Which property states to multiply the exponents when raising a power to another power?

The correct choice, which states to multiply the exponents when raising a power to another power, is known as the Power of a Power Property. This property mathematically expresses that when you take an exponent, say (a^m), and raise it to another exponent (n), you multiply the exponents:

[

(a^m)^n = a^{m \cdot n}

]

This means if you have (2^3) raised to the 4th power, it would be calculated as follows:

[

(2^3)^4 = 2^{3 \cdot 4} = 2^{12}

]

Understanding this property is crucial because it simplifies calculations involving exponents and allows for more complex algebraic manipulations.

The other choices refer to different exponent laws. The Product of Powers property involves adding exponents when multiplying two powers with the same base, while the Quotient of Powers property details how to subtract exponents when dividing powers with the same base. Lastly, the Power of a Quotient covers the rule for raising a fraction to a power by applying the exponent to both the numerator and the denominator, again indicating differences in how exponents function in various operations.
